|
RetroArch
|
#include "rpc.h"#include "rpcndr.h"#include "windows.h"#include "ole2.h"#include "oaidl.h"#include "ocidl.h"#include "dxgi1_2.h"#include "d3dcommon.h"#include "d3d11.h"Go to the source code of this file.
Classes | |
| struct | D3D11_RENDER_TARGET_BLEND_DESC1 |
| struct | D3D11_BLEND_DESC1 |
| struct | ID3D11BlendState1Vtbl |
| struct | D3D11_RASTERIZER_DESC1 |
| struct | ID3D11RasterizerState1Vtbl |
| struct | ID3DDeviceContextStateVtbl |
| struct | ID3D11DeviceContext1Vtbl |
| struct | D3D11_VIDEO_DECODER_SUB_SAMPLE_MAPPING_BLOCK |
| struct | D3D11_VIDEO_DECODER_BUFFER_DESC1 |
| struct | D3D11_VIDEO_DECODER_BEGIN_FRAME_CRYPTO_SESSION |
| struct | D3D11_VIDEO_PROCESSOR_STREAM_BEHAVIOR_HINT |
| struct | D3D11_KEY_EXCHANGE_HW_PROTECTION_INPUT_DATA |
| struct | D3D11_KEY_EXCHANGE_HW_PROTECTION_OUTPUT_DATA |
| struct | D3D11_KEY_EXCHANGE_HW_PROTECTION_DATA |
| struct | D3D11_VIDEO_SAMPLE_DESC |
| struct | ID3D11VideoContext1Vtbl |
| struct | ID3D11VideoDevice1Vtbl |
| struct | ID3D11VideoProcessorEnumerator1Vtbl |
| struct | ID3D11Device1Vtbl |
| struct | ID3DUserDefinedAnnotationVtbl |
Macros | |
| #define | __REQUIRED_RPCNDR_H_VERSION__ 475 |
| #define | __REQUIRED_RPCSAL_H_VERSION__ 100 |
| #define | __ID3D11BlendState1_FWD_DEFINED__ |
| #define | __ID3D11RasterizerState1_FWD_DEFINED__ |
| #define | __ID3DDeviceContextState_FWD_DEFINED__ |
| #define | __ID3D11DeviceContext1_FWD_DEFINED__ |
| #define | __ID3D11VideoContext1_FWD_DEFINED__ |
| #define | __ID3D11VideoDevice1_FWD_DEFINED__ |
| #define | __ID3D11VideoProcessorEnumerator1_FWD_DEFINED__ |
| #define | __ID3D11Device1_FWD_DEFINED__ |
| #define | __ID3DUserDefinedAnnotation_FWD_DEFINED__ |
| #define | __ID3D11BlendState1_INTERFACE_DEFINED__ |
| #define | __ID3D11RasterizerState1_INTERFACE_DEFINED__ |
| #define | __ID3DDeviceContextState_INTERFACE_DEFINED__ |
| #define | __ID3D11DeviceContext1_INTERFACE_DEFINED__ |
| #define | __ID3D11VideoContext1_INTERFACE_DEFINED__ |
| #define | __ID3D11VideoDevice1_INTERFACE_DEFINED__ |
| #define | __ID3D11VideoProcessorEnumerator1_INTERFACE_DEFINED__ |
| #define | __ID3D11Device1_INTERFACE_DEFINED__ |
| #define | __ID3DUserDefinedAnnotation_INTERFACE_DEFINED__ |
Functions | |
| DEFINE_GUID (IID_ID3D11BlendState1, 0xcc86fabe, 0xda55, 0x401d, 0x85, 0xe7, 0xe3, 0xc9, 0xde, 0x28, 0x77, 0xe9) | |
| DEFINE_GUID (IID_ID3D11RasterizerState1, 0x1217d7a6, 0x5039, 0x418c, 0xb0, 0x42, 0x9c, 0xbe, 0x25, 0x6a, 0xfd, 0x6e) | |
| DEFINE_GUID (IID_ID3DDeviceContextState, 0x5c1e0d8a, 0x7c23, 0x48f9, 0x8c, 0x59, 0xa9, 0x29, 0x58, 0xce, 0xff, 0x11) | |
| DEFINE_GUID (IID_ID3D11DeviceContext1, 0xbb2c6faa, 0xb5fb, 0x4082, 0x8e, 0x6b, 0x38, 0x8b, 0x8c, 0xfa, 0x90, 0xe1) | |
| DEFINE_GUID (IID_ID3D11VideoContext1, 0xA7F026DA, 0xA5F8, 0x4487, 0xA5, 0x64, 0x15, 0xE3, 0x43, 0x57, 0x65, 0x1E) | |
| DEFINE_GUID (IID_ID3D11VideoDevice1, 0x29DA1D51, 0x1321, 0x4454, 0x80, 0x4B, 0xF5, 0xFC, 0x9F, 0x86, 0x1F, 0x0F) | |
| DEFINE_GUID (IID_ID3D11VideoProcessorEnumerator1, 0x465217F2, 0x5568, 0x43CF, 0xB5, 0xB9, 0xF6, 0x1D, 0x54, 0x53, 0x1C, 0xA1) | |
| DEFINE_GUID (IID_ID3D11Device1, 0xa04bfb29, 0x08ef, 0x43d6, 0xa4, 0x9c, 0xa9, 0xbd, 0xbd, 0xcb, 0xe6, 0x86) | |
| DEFINE_GUID (IID_ID3DUserDefinedAnnotation, 0xb2daad8b, 0x03d4, 0x4dbf, 0x95, 0xeb, 0x32, 0xab, 0x4b, 0x63, 0xd0, 0xab) | |
Variables | |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0000_v0_0_c_ifspec |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0000_v0_0_s_ifspec |
| EXTERN_C const IID | IID_ID3D11BlendState1 |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0001_v0_0_c_ifspec |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0001_v0_0_s_ifspec |
| EXTERN_C const IID | IID_ID3D11RasterizerState1 |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0002_v0_0_c_ifspec |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0002_v0_0_s_ifspec |
| EXTERN_C const IID | IID_ID3DDeviceContextState |
| EXTERN_C const IID | IID_ID3D11DeviceContext1 |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0004_v0_0_c_ifspec |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0004_v0_0_s_ifspec |
| EXTERN_C const IID | IID_ID3D11VideoContext1 |
| EXTERN_C const IID | IID_ID3D11VideoDevice1 |
| EXTERN_C const IID | IID_ID3D11VideoProcessorEnumerator1 |
| EXTERN_C const IID | IID_ID3D11Device1 |
| EXTERN_C const IID | IID_ID3DUserDefinedAnnotation |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0009_v0_0_c_ifspec |
| RPC_IF_HANDLE | __MIDL_itf_d3d11_1_0000_0009_v0_0_s_ifspec |
| #define __ID3D11BlendState1_FWD_DEFINED__ |
| #define __ID3D11BlendState1_INTERFACE_DEFINED__ |
| #define __ID3D11Device1_FWD_DEFINED__ |
| #define __ID3D11Device1_INTERFACE_DEFINED__ |
| #define __ID3D11DeviceContext1_FWD_DEFINED__ |
| #define __ID3D11DeviceContext1_INTERFACE_DEFINED__ |
| #define __ID3D11RasterizerState1_FWD_DEFINED__ |
| #define __ID3D11RasterizerState1_INTERFACE_DEFINED__ |
| #define __ID3D11VideoContext1_FWD_DEFINED__ |
| #define __ID3D11VideoContext1_INTERFACE_DEFINED__ |
| #define __ID3D11VideoDevice1_FWD_DEFINED__ |
| #define __ID3D11VideoDevice1_INTERFACE_DEFINED__ |
| #define __ID3D11VideoProcessorEnumerator1_FWD_DEFINED__ |
| #define __ID3D11VideoProcessorEnumerator1_INTERFACE_DEFINED__ |
| #define __ID3DDeviceContextState_FWD_DEFINED__ |
| #define __ID3DDeviceContextState_INTERFACE_DEFINED__ |
| #define __ID3DUserDefinedAnnotation_FWD_DEFINED__ |
| #define __ID3DUserDefinedAnnotation_INTERFACE_DEFINED__ |
| #define __REQUIRED_RPCNDR_H_VERSION__ 475 |
| #define __REQUIRED_RPCSAL_H_VERSION__ 100 |
| typedef struct D3D11_BLEND_DESC1 D3D11_BLEND_DESC1 |
| typedef enum D3D11_COPY_FLAGS D3D11_COPY_FLAGS |
| typedef enum D3D11_CRYPTO_SESSION_STATUS D3D11_CRYPTO_SESSION_STATUS |
| typedef struct D3D11_KEY_EXCHANGE_HW_PROTECTION_INPUT_DATA D3D11_KEY_EXCHANGE_HW_PROTECTION_INPUT_DATA |
| typedef struct D3D11_KEY_EXCHANGE_HW_PROTECTION_OUTPUT_DATA D3D11_KEY_EXCHANGE_HW_PROTECTION_OUTPUT_DATA |
| typedef enum D3D11_LOGIC_OP D3D11_LOGIC_OP |
| typedef struct D3D11_RASTERIZER_DESC1 D3D11_RASTERIZER_DESC1 |
| typedef struct D3D11_RENDER_TARGET_BLEND_DESC1 D3D11_RENDER_TARGET_BLEND_DESC1 |
| typedef struct D3D11_VIDEO_DECODER_BEGIN_FRAME_CRYPTO_SESSION D3D11_VIDEO_DECODER_BEGIN_FRAME_CRYPTO_SESSION |
| typedef struct D3D11_VIDEO_DECODER_BUFFER_DESC1 D3D11_VIDEO_DECODER_BUFFER_DESC1 |
| typedef enum D3D11_VIDEO_DECODER_CAPS D3D11_VIDEO_DECODER_CAPS |
| typedef struct D3D11_VIDEO_DECODER_SUB_SAMPLE_MAPPING_BLOCK D3D11_VIDEO_DECODER_SUB_SAMPLE_MAPPING_BLOCK |
| typedef struct D3D11_VIDEO_PROCESSOR_STREAM_BEHAVIOR_HINT D3D11_VIDEO_PROCESSOR_STREAM_BEHAVIOR_HINT |
| typedef struct D3D11_VIDEO_SAMPLE_DESC D3D11_VIDEO_SAMPLE_DESC |
| typedef interface ID3D11BlendState1 ID3D11BlendState1 |
| typedef struct ID3D11BlendState1Vtbl ID3D11BlendState1Vtbl |
| typedef interface ID3D11Device1 ID3D11Device1 |
| typedef struct ID3D11Device1Vtbl ID3D11Device1Vtbl |
| typedef interface ID3D11DeviceContext1 ID3D11DeviceContext1 |
| typedef struct ID3D11DeviceContext1Vtbl ID3D11DeviceContext1Vtbl |
| typedef interface ID3D11RasterizerState1 ID3D11RasterizerState1 |
| typedef struct ID3D11RasterizerState1Vtbl ID3D11RasterizerState1Vtbl |
| typedef interface ID3D11VideoContext1 ID3D11VideoContext1 |
| typedef struct ID3D11VideoContext1Vtbl ID3D11VideoContext1Vtbl |
| typedef interface ID3D11VideoDevice1 ID3D11VideoDevice1 |
| typedef struct ID3D11VideoDevice1Vtbl ID3D11VideoDevice1Vtbl |
| typedef interface ID3D11VideoProcessorEnumerator1 ID3D11VideoProcessorEnumerator1 |
| typedef interface ID3DDeviceContextState ID3DDeviceContextState |
| typedef struct ID3DDeviceContextStateVtbl ID3DDeviceContextStateVtbl |
| typedef interface ID3DUserDefinedAnnotation ID3DUserDefinedAnnotation |
| typedef struct ID3DUserDefinedAnnotationVtbl ID3DUserDefinedAnnotationVtbl |
| enum D3D11_COPY_FLAGS |
| enum D3D11_LOGIC_OP |
| DEFINE_GUID | ( | IID_ID3D11BlendState1 | , |
| 0xcc86fabe | , | ||
| 0xda55 | , | ||
| 0x401d | , | ||
| 0x85 | , | ||
| 0xe7 | , | ||
| 0xe3 | , | ||
| 0xc9 | , | ||
| 0xde | , | ||
| 0x28 | , | ||
| 0x77 | , | ||
| 0xe9 | |||
| ) |
| DEFINE_GUID | ( | IID_ID3D11RasterizerState1 | , |
| 0x1217d7a6 | , | ||
| 0x5039 | , | ||
| 0x418c | , | ||
| 0xb0 | , | ||
| 0x42 | , | ||
| 0x9c | , | ||
| 0xbe | , | ||
| 0x25 | , | ||
| 0x6a | , | ||
| 0xfd | , | ||
| 0x6e | |||
| ) |
| DEFINE_GUID | ( | IID_ID3DDeviceContextState | , |
| 0x5c1e0d8a | , | ||
| 0x7c23 | , | ||
| 0x48f9 | , | ||
| 0x8c | , | ||
| 0x59 | , | ||
| 0xa9 | , | ||
| 0x29 | , | ||
| 0x58 | , | ||
| 0xce | , | ||
| 0xff | , | ||
| 0x11 | |||
| ) |
| DEFINE_GUID | ( | IID_ID3D11DeviceContext1 | , |
| 0xbb2c6faa | , | ||
| 0xb5fb | , | ||
| 0x4082 | , | ||
| 0x8e | , | ||
| 0x6b | , | ||
| 0x38 | , | ||
| 0x8b | , | ||
| 0x8c | , | ||
| 0xfa | , | ||
| 0x90 | , | ||
| 0xe1 | |||
| ) |
| DEFINE_GUID | ( | IID_ID3D11VideoContext1 | , |
| 0xA7F026DA | , | ||
| 0xA5F8 | , | ||
| 0x4487 | , | ||
| 0xA5 | , | ||
| 0x64 | , | ||
| 0x15 | , | ||
| 0xE3 | , | ||
| 0x43 | , | ||
| 0x57 | , | ||
| 0x65 | , | ||
| 0x1E | |||
| ) |
| DEFINE_GUID | ( | IID_ID3D11VideoDevice1 | , |
| 0x29DA1D51 | , | ||
| 0x1321 | , | ||
| 0x4454 | , | ||
| 0x80 | , | ||
| 0x4B | , | ||
| 0xF5 | , | ||
| 0xFC | , | ||
| 0x9F | , | ||
| 0x86 | , | ||
| 0x1F | , | ||
| 0x0F | |||
| ) |
| DEFINE_GUID | ( | IID_ID3D11VideoProcessorEnumerator1 | , |
| 0x465217F2 | , | ||
| 0x5568 | , | ||
| 0x43CF | , | ||
| 0xB5 | , | ||
| 0xB9 | , | ||
| 0xF6 | , | ||
| 0x1D | , | ||
| 0x54 | , | ||
| 0x53 | , | ||
| 0x1C | , | ||
| 0xA1 | |||
| ) |
| DEFINE_GUID | ( | IID_ID3D11Device1 | , |
| 0xa04bfb29 | , | ||
| 0x08ef | , | ||
| 0x43d6 | , | ||
| 0xa4 | , | ||
| 0x9c | , | ||
| 0xa9 | , | ||
| 0xbd | , | ||
| 0xbd | , | ||
| 0xcb | , | ||
| 0xe6 | , | ||
| 0x86 | |||
| ) |
| DEFINE_GUID | ( | IID_ID3DUserDefinedAnnotation | , |
| 0xb2daad8b | , | ||
| 0x03d4 | , | ||
| 0x4dbf | , | ||
| 0x95 | , | ||
| 0xeb | , | ||
| 0x32 | , | ||
| 0xab | , | ||
| 0x4b | , | ||
| 0x63 | , | ||
| 0xd0 | , | ||
| 0xab | |||
| ) |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0000_v0_0_c_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0000_v0_0_s_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0001_v0_0_c_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0001_v0_0_s_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0002_v0_0_c_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0002_v0_0_s_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0004_v0_0_c_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0004_v0_0_s_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0009_v0_0_c_ifspec |
| RPC_IF_HANDLE __MIDL_itf_d3d11_1_0000_0009_v0_0_s_ifspec |
| EXTERN_C const IID IID_ID3D11BlendState1 |
| EXTERN_C const IID IID_ID3D11Device1 |
| EXTERN_C const IID IID_ID3D11DeviceContext1 |
| EXTERN_C const IID IID_ID3D11RasterizerState1 |
| EXTERN_C const IID IID_ID3D11VideoContext1 |
| EXTERN_C const IID IID_ID3D11VideoDevice1 |
| EXTERN_C const IID IID_ID3D11VideoProcessorEnumerator1 |
| EXTERN_C const IID IID_ID3DDeviceContextState |
| EXTERN_C const IID IID_ID3DUserDefinedAnnotation |
1.8.15